Right to BRAG
Liz Volz and Ron Helms have been friends for three years and participated in the Bicycle Ride Across Georgia, June 2-9, 2012. They lifted weights and focused on strength training for three months to prepare for BRAG, a 359-mile trek from Oglethorp to Tiger in the foothills of Georgia’s Appalachian Mountains. (Courtesy photo)

Arkansas Reserve unit wins Port Dawg Challenge
The Top Dawg trophy is claimed by the 96th Aerial Port Squadron, Little Rock Air Force Base, Ark., at the conclusion of the Air Force Reserve Command’s 2012 Port Dawg Challenge. The 96th six-person team bested 18 other teams from as far away as Hawaii. (U.S. Air Force photo/Master Sgt. Chris Durney)
